Le secret du chef

To neutralize the ammonia taste in shark, soak it in buttermilk, milk, or diluted vinegar for at least an hour before cooking.

Substituts & Proportions pour Shark

Le meilleur substitut pour le/la/l'Shark est Swordfish, à utiliser dans un rapport de 1:1. Similar firm, meaty texture and strong flavor, ideal for grilling or searing.

Substituts pour Shark avec proportions
Substitut Proportion Idéal pour
Swordfish Meilleur 1:1 Similar firm, meaty texture and strong flavor, ideal for grilling or searing.
Marlin 1:1 Another large, firm-fleshed fish with a robust flavor profile, great for steaks.
Tuna (Steak) 1:1 Offers a meaty texture and strong flavor, though often less gamey than shark.
Monkfish 1:1 Known as "poor man's lobster," firm and mild, good for various cooking methods.
